This episode, titled originally aired in November 2010 and features a memorable guest appearance by John Amos . Episode Summary

The plot centers on and Alan attempting to set up Evelyn (their mother) with Ed (played by Amos), the father of Alan’s then-girlfriend, Lyndsey. The brothers hope that if their mother is occupied with a new relationship, she will stop meddling in their lives. However, the plan backfires when Ed reveals he is actually more interested in a casual "friends with benefits" arrangement rather than the high-society romance Evelyn expects.
